Immunotherapy, a groundbreaking approach that harnesses the body's immune system to fight cancer, has been revolutionizing the field of oncology. In recent years, immunotherapeutic drugs known as immune checkpoint inhibitors have shown remarkable success in treating various types of cancer. While ovarian cancer has proven to be less responsive to these drugs, ongoing research is focused on identifying novel strategies to enhance their effectiveness.
One such approach involves combining immune checkpoint inhibitors with targeted therapies. By targeting specific genetic mutations or pathways unique to ovarian cancer cells, researchers aim to create a more tailored and effective treatment approach. These combination therapies hold great promise in improving response rates and extending survival for ovarian cancer patients.
Another area of intense research is the development of PARP inhibitors. Poly (ADP-ribose) polymerase (PARP) is an enzyme involved in repairing damaged DNA. PARP inhibitors work by blocking this repair mechanism, leading to the accumulation of DNA damage in cancer cells, ultimately causing their death. These drugs have already shown significant success in treating ovarian cancer patients with BRCA gene mutations. Ongoing studies are now exploring their potential in broader patient populations and in combination with other treatments.
Furthermore, targeted therapies that aim to disrupt specific molecular pathways involved in ovarian cancer progression are also being investigated. For instance, drugs that target angiogenesis, the process by which tumors develop new blood vessels to sustain their growth, have shown promise in clinical trials. By inhibiting angiogenesis, these therapies can starve the tumor of its blood supply, limiting its ability to grow and spread.
In addition to these novel treatment approaches, advancements in precision medicine and genetic testing are shaping the future of ovarian cancer treatment. By analyzing the genetic makeup of individual tumors, researchers can identify specific mutations or alterations that drive cancer growth. This knowledge enables the development of personalized treatment strategies, tailoring therapies to target the unique characteristics of each patient's cancer.
